Public Relations Director directs and implements a company's public relations strategies. Manages media relations, announcements, editorial placement, and speaking opportunities. Being a Public Relations Director evaluates and authorizes all forms of communication regarding the organization for release to the public. Develops press releases, white papers and supporting materials. Additionally, Public Relations Director requires a bachelor's degree. Typically reports to top management. The Public Relations Director manages a departmental sub-function within a broader departmental function. Creates functional strategies and specific objectives for the sub-function and develops budgets/policies/procedures to support the functional infrastructure. Deep knowledge of the managed sub-function and solid knowledge of the overall departmental function. To be a Public Relations Director typically requires 5+ years of managerial experience. About All Our Kin
All Our Kin, a national nonprofit that trains, supports, and sustains family child care educators, seeks a Director of Marketing and Public Relations. This innovator and strategic thinker will have the passion to advance the field of family child care, the expertise to elevate our programming to diverse audiences, and the ability to write compelling copy that gets attention and results.
Through All Our Kin’s high-touch programming, family child care educators – who nurture our youngest learners from their own homes – succeed as small business owners and early childhood specialists. In turn, parents have access to high-quality, affordable child care, and infants and toddlers gain the enriching experiences that prepare them to succeed.
